Output ee578a1a1bc0c7e31203bf91630c9af9df6a7e707d54b5504670232a5e5bcc3f:1

value
21042330
script pubkey
OP_0 OP_PUSHBYTES_20 f89508a3d07536dc473108cc73125bbe43fd33fa
address
bc1qlz2s3g7sw5mdc3e3prx8xyjmhepl6vl6l9rq08
transaction
ee578a1a1bc0c7e31203bf91630c9af9df6a7e707d54b5504670232a5e5bcc3f